“…Authors such as Brown & Trucker [11], show that the aeration efficiency by paddle wheel devices is directly related to the increase on the rotation speed and length of the paddles, generating an increase in costs and power required. Low RPMs in paddle aerators favor the volumetric transport of water when compared to conventional methods and equipment [12,13]. At high RPMs, there is a lower oxygen transference due to the volumes of air used and higher energy costs.…”
